LabVIEW
예제]성능 최적화- vi 프로퍼티:실행
큰 프로그램을 열심히 짜서, 돌렸는데, 프로그램이 버벅된다는 느낌을 받을때가 있다. 랩뷰 프로그램에서는 자주 그러지 않나 싶다. 여러가지 이유가 있지만, while loop 남용, 스파게티 코드 등 이번에는 좀 더 프로그램을 최적화 방법이다. LabVIEW 예제에 보면 최적화에 관련 예제 가 있는데, subVI에 관한 예제를 다루고 있다. 1억번에 for 루프를 돌면서 더하기 계산을 하고 있는데, 이를 5가지 방법으로 구현했을때, 걸리는 시간을 확인하고 있다. 결과적으로 보면 첫번째와 5번째가 시간이 가장 적게 걸리는것으로 나온다. 여기서 사용할 vi 프로퍼티 창에서 실행관련 옵션을 조정하면서 테스트 할 것이다. 이 옵션은 상황에 맞게 설정해서 사용해야 한다. FGV를 이용하여 함수를 만들었는데, 성능을..
2022. 2. 12. 11:33